Okay… here we go with the explanations:

Frankly the Top 5 could be in almost any order and I would be okay with it. It will solve itself as the season progresses. BYU at #6 is overrated, I know, but you can thank Penn State’s icky performance at Purdue and my non belief in Texas Tech against real teams for that. Undefeated Vandy (3-0 in the SEC by the way) gets to crack the Top 10 for now. I mean, why not?

Georgia, UF hang around the same spots, Oklahoma State moves up because they keep winning. I expect a fall from grace when the start playing real teams, like Mizzou who should whoop them next week. Southern Cal looked better this weekend against the Ducks, so I moved them up, and Boise State keeps winning, even if it’s ugly. Consider that a little home away from home bias for the Broncos by me, since I like their style.

On to the ACC Bias… Virginia Tech has ugly jerseys… horribly ugly orange and whatever purple brown goes with it. But that’s better than earwax (GT) so it’s the Hokies and the Yellow Jackets, in that order. Ball State remains undefeated, so until they lose they’ll march up to #12 as a potential BCS buster. Oh, and I’m happy with Ohio State at 19 after a good game against Wisconsin.

For the rest? Your guess is as good as mine. I think Tulsa and Michigan State deserve it, but I can be swayed. South Florida hangs on, because Maryland lost to freakin’ Virginia. VIRGINIA!
